Vegetarian Caesar Salad (No Anchovies!)

Description
Vegetarian Caesar Salad (No Anchovies!) features a rich dressing crafted from olive oil, mayonnaise, and Parmesan cheese, balanced with lemon juice, Dijon mustard, and fresh garlic. This creates a creamy, tangy dressing that coats crisp romaine or mixed greens. The salad is completed with crunchy croutons and additional shaved Parmesan cheese for texture and taste contrast. The ingredients come together in a simple toss, preserving the freshness and crunchiness of the greens and croutons.
The dressing's preparation uses a blender to achieve a smooth consistency, ensuring even coverage over the salad. This vegetarian version omits anchovies but retains the characteristic Caesar flavor profile through the combination of mayonnaise and Parmesan.
Best served fresh, the salad works well as a light meal or starter. Keeping the dressing and croutons separate until just before serving prevents sogginess and maintains texture.
To store leftovers, keep dressing and salad components in airtight containers in the fridge for up to four days, assembling just before eating. The recipe can also be easily adapted to a vegan version by substituting vegan mayonnaise and Parmesan alternatives.
Ingredients
Dressing
- ½ cup olive oil 120 mL
- ¼ cup mayonnaise 60 g
- ¼ cup Parmesan Cheese 30 g, shaved
- 2 Tbsp lemon juice 30 mL
- 1 ½ tsp Dijon mustard 7 g
- 1 clove garlic
- salt to taste
- black pepper to taste
Salad
- 5 romaine lettuce heaping cups, chopped, or mixed greens
- 2 cups croutons
- ½ cup Parmesan Cheese 60 g, shaved
Instructions
- Make Dressing: Add all Dressing ingredients to a blender and blitz until smooth and creamy. Taste and add salt and pepper, as needed.
- Assemble: Roughly chop romaine or mixed greens. Toss together with croutons and parmesan. Drizzle with dressing and toss to coat (you may not need all of the dressing).
Notes
- Store dressing and croutons separately from greens to maintain freshness and texture.
- Use air-tight containers in the refrigerator to keep all components fresh up to four days.
- For a vegan version, substitute regular mayonnaise and Parmesan cheese with vegan alternatives.
